Student Assistant - Library Makerspace (Spring)
University of Oklahoma, Norman, Oklahoma, us, 73019
Job Title
Student Assistant – Library Makerspace (Spring)
Job Information
Job Number: 260042
Location: Norman, Oklahoma
Schedule: Part‑time, Flexible 9am‑7pm
Work Type: Onsite
Salary: $10.00 per hour
Benefits: None
Description This position will work in the Library Makerspace on the main floor of Bizzell Memorial Library. Workers will greet patrons, demonstrate equipment capabilities, troubleshoot basic issues, and guide users through workflows for technologies including introductory 3D scanning, 3D printing, Virtual Reality, Cricut cutting machines, and related design processes.
Students receive hands‑on training on all technologies so they can effectively support patrons and maintain equipment.
Responsibilities
Operate and maintain technology to expected standards.
Keep the space clean, organized, and welcoming.
Demonstrate oral and written communication skills, communicating effectively with patrons at varying technological skill levels.
Help patrons envision innovative ways to use OU Libraries.
Perform other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
Currently enrolled in the Spring 2026 term as a student at the University of Oklahoma.
Must attach Spring 2026 class schedule.
Communicate effectively in written and oral English.
Ability to explain technical subjects to novices.
Multi‑task and manage time effectively.
Maintain a professional appearance and manner.
Willingness to learn and interact with new technology.
Preference for students with previous customer service experience.
Prior experience in 3D printing, virtual reality, and electronics preferred but not required.
Physical & Other Requirements
Regular bending, stooping, reaching, stretching, standing for extended periods, frequent computer use, and light lifting.
Must be subject to background check and police records check.
Final candidate subject to university tuberculosis testing policy.
